Twon Wood
Twon Wood is a stand-up comedian and lifelong skateboarder whose style hits as hard as it rolls smooth. A standout in the Seattle International Comedy Contest, he’s brought his high-energy, sharp-edged comedy to stages including The Comedy Studio (Boston), Don’t Tell Comedy, Tampa Pro, and Wisecrackers.

On screen, he’s appeared onSupreme Justice with Judge Karen Mills, and offstage, he’s deep-rooted in skate culture — his zineHill-Bomberwas featured inThrasher Magazine. Twon blends grit, charisma, and real-world perspective into a set that feels raw, original, and built for any room.

Billy Prinsell
Billy Prinsell is a New York City based comedian who was one of Comedy Central’s ‘Comic’s to Watch.’ He has a comedy special on Amazon and Apple TV called “Hunka Bunka’s” about growing up and dating. In addition to performing he writes sketches and produces shows with Pure Chaos Comedy, a comedy collective. Recently he was a part of the Vermont Comedy Festival and was a winner of the ‘One Minute Joke Battle.’

Devin Bramble
Devin Bramble is a Long Island based observational comedian. Raised on classic 90's geek culture and influenced by his Southern and Caribbean roots, he helped merge those perspectives with a classical New York suburban upbringing. Known for his bombastic voice and poetic prose, he performs all over the tri-state area.

Julia Colasanti
Julia Colasanti is a Burlington, VT-based comic with roots in the Midwest and a heart of gold. She’s performed from Madison, Wisconsin to Portland, ME and opened for some of the greats like Amy Miller, Casey Balsham and Yamaneika Saunders.   She's been featured in the Vermont Comedy Festival and for the past two years, she’s produced monthly themed comedy shows at Lincolns in Burlington, VT where the comics come in costume and the crowd hoots and hollers.
